From Whalebone Arch, Bragar to Aberdeen by bus and ferry

To get from Whalebone Arch, Bragar to Aberdeen in Scotland,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one ferry line: take the W2 bus from Pairc An Duin, South Bragar station to Bus Station, Stornoway station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the CM25 ferry, then the and finally take the 10B bus from Bus Station Stance 5, Inverness station to Union Square Bus Station, Aberdeen station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 14 hr 16 min. The bus and ferry schedule from Whalebone Arch, Bragar may change.
